I have a similar problem at the moment. Until recently I had a CRT television connected to my Media Center. I have a Asus Geforce 8400 graphics card with S-video out. I just split the stereo sound between the TV and my amp.

When I upgraded to a Full HD LCD, I had to get a DVI-HDMI adapter, but of course it has no sound over the HDMI.

I have now ordered a Asus Geforce 9400GT Silent graphics card with built-in HDMI. The card ships with a cable for connecting the spdif output on the mobo to the graphics card. The card will then also output sound over the HDMI.
